Tesla Robotaxis Under Investigation for Traffic Violations in Austin

- π Tesla's robotaxis have begun operating on public roads in Austin, Texas, offering rides within a limited city zone.
- β οΈ The US National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) is seeking information on the operation due to alleged traffic violations.
- π The NHTSA has reviewed online videos that reportedly show a robotaxi speeding and another using the wrong lane.
- π« Tesla did not respond to Reuters' request for comment, but CEO Elon Musk has stated the company is highly focused on safety.
- β οΈ The robotaxis are programmed to avoid bad weather and difficult intersections, and will not carry children.
Lawsuit Over Model S Crash and "Full Self-Driving"
- βοΈ Separately, Tesla faces a lawsuit in New Jersey from the estates of three individuals killed in a crash involving a Model S sedan.
- π₯ The suit alleges that defective and unreasonably dangerous design of the "full self-driving" feature led to the deaths.
- β οΈ Plaintiffs claim the system creates an impression of full autonomy that it cannot deliver, failing in many everyday driving situations.
- β οΈ Tesla maintains that the "full self-driving" feature requires attentive drivers with hands on the steering wheel.
- π« Tesla also did not comment on the lawsuit when contacted by Reuters.
